Output 3ef058aa80c4daf7e83fa51bb12f97d065c35ebb1d20090e81d2c9585e38f9b2:76

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5af7d73ecc2ad7da8b2db05edd2dc62f2f081baad387346065e0e6b006acf94b
address
bc1pttmaw0kv9tta4zedkp0d6twx9uhssxa26wrngcr9urntqp4vl99shgy93j
transaction
3ef058aa80c4daf7e83fa51bb12f97d065c35ebb1d20090e81d2c9585e38f9b2
spent
true